Recognizing Bail Bonds
In the realm of the criminal justice system, comprehending Bail bonds is important for individuals seeking prompt release from guardianship. Bail bonds work as a financial warranty that a defendant will certainly show up in court after being released from jail. When an individual is arrested, a judge normally sets a bond quantity based upon aspects such as the seriousness of the offense, trip threat, and prior criminal history.
For lots of, the complete Bail quantity may be unattainable, prompting the requirement for a bail bond. A bail bond firm can provide a guaranty bond, allowing the defendant to pay a portion of the total Bail quantity-- commonly around 10%-- to safeguard their release. This charge is non-refundable, despite the outcome of the case.
Additionally, Bail bonds commonly include a co-signer, normally a member of the family or friend, that agrees to make certain the accused appears in court. Sorts Of Bail Bond Options
A number of kinds of bail bond alternatives are available to people looking for immediate alleviation from incarceration. The most typical is the guaranty bond, which entails a bail bondsman who ensures the full Bail quantity to the court for a fee, generally around 10% of the Bail quantity. This choice is specifically advantageous for those that can not pay for the complete Bail sum upfront.
One more alternative is a cash money bond, where the defendant or a depictive pays the complete Bail quantity in money to the court. This technique is often liked since it permits quicker release, and the sum total is refunded upon court resolution, assuming all problems are fulfilled.
A home bond is an additional option, in which the defendant utilizes property as security to safeguard their launch. This can be a viable alternative for people who have substantial equity in their property.
Finally, some jurisdictions use personal recognizance bonds, enabling offenders to be launched based on their pledge to return for court days, usually evaluated on a case-by-case basis. Each choice has special implications and demands, making it critical for people to review their certain situations when selecting a bail bond kind.
Costs Connected With Bail Bonds
Understanding the prices linked with Bail bonds is essential for offenders and their family members as they browse the legal system. The primary expense of getting a bail bond is the premium, which typically varies from 10% to 15% of the complete Bail amount.
Additionally, there might be management fees that can vary by bail bond company. These costs can cover paperwork and handling costs. Some companies may likewise bill security requirements, where people have to provide assets, such as residential or commercial property or automobiles, to safeguard the bond.
It's critical to review the great print of any bail bond arrangement thoroughly. Effective budgeting and clear communication with the Bail bonding firm are crucial for handling these costs.

The Bail Bond Process
The bail bond process is an important component of the legal system that enables offenders to safeguard their launch from custody while awaiting test. When an individual is jailed and subsequently booked into prison, this process begins. A judge normally sets a bail quantity throughout the accusation, which mirrors the intensity of the infraction and the defendant's trip risk
If the Bail amount is regarded too expensive for the offender to pay, they can seek support from a bail bond representative. The agent needs a charge, usually a percentage of the total Bail, and may additionally demand collateral to alleviate their danger.
